# Break-Glass: Catalog Cache Invalidation

Scope: the Pinrow product catalog at Veldstone Retail. If stale prices persist after a purge and the Hollowmere invalidation queue is wedged, use break-glass to flush the edge tier directly. Contractors: get verbal sign-off from the catalog lead first. Steps: open the Hollowmere admin shell, select emergency-flush, confirm the tenant, and run it once — repeated flushes thrash the origin. Access is logged and expires after 20 minutes. Unseal the admin shell with the passphrase below.

recovery phrase for kahop-tajog: istix-casvan

## Authentication

Hey plugin folks! Every call to the PerkLedger API needs a bearer token in the Authorization header. Tokens are scoped to read or write point balances, so request only what your plugin actually needs. They expire after 12 hours, and refreshing is cheap, so don't hoard them. For sandbox testing against the Vexhall cluster, use the token below.

session JWT of yawep-yawep = eyJhbGciOiJIUzI1NiIsInR5cCI6IkpXVCJ9.eyJzdWIiOiI3pWF3_In0.aXYsHiog

Team — Quillpress markdown pipeline update is staged. Sanitizer now strips raw HTML blocks before the extension pass, not after, closing the injection window flagged last sprint. Link rewriting is unchanged. Fuzz suite ran clean for 48 hours. Security review needed on the new allowlist logic only; everything else is mechanical. Please complete review before Thursday's cut. The staged artifact is identified by the trace token below.

session token of bawep-yadup = htk21_528abd376e3c5a4ec24a1

Handing off the Quillbus broker upgrade (4.x to 5.1) to Dario. Cluster is half-migrated; mixed-version mode is supported but TLS cert rotation must finish before cutover. No auth model changes, though the admin API gained two new endpoints worth reviewing. Open questions and the migration checklist are tracked on the internal page below.

dashboard of taduf-bawef = https://jira.lumicsys.internal/projects/display/browse/b1cbf89d